Key Bible Verses


  1. 1 Peter 3:15 - "But in your hearts revere Christ as Lord. Always be prepared to give an answer to everyone who asks you to give the reason for the hope that you have. But do this with gentleness and respect."


  2. Colossians 4:5-6 - "Be wise in the way you act toward outsiders; make the most of every opportunity. Let your conversation be always full of grace, seasoned with salt, so that you may know how to answer everyone."


  3. Romans 1:16 - "For I am not ashamed of the gospel, because it is the power of God that brings salvation to everyone who believes: first to the Jew, then to the Gentile."


Reflection


The call to share our hope in Christ has been an essential aspect of Christian discipleship since the earliest days of the church. The Apostle Paul, a pioneering missionary and a transformative figure in the spread of Christianity, exemplified this practice by boldly proclaiming the gospel message across the ancient world.


In 1 Peter 3:15, we are instructed to be prepared to give an answer for the hope that we have in Christ, emphasizing the importance of grounding our personal testimonies in a deep understanding of the gospel message. By cultivating a readiness to engage in faith-based conversations, we can offer thoughtful and genuine accounts of our spiritual journeys that inspire and encourage others.


Colossians 4:5-6 further highlights the importance of approaching these discussions with wisdom, grace, and a sincere desire to connect with those who may not yet know Christ. This passage serves as a reminder that our testimonies are most powerful when delivered with a spirit of humility and compassion, acknowledging the unique experiences and questions of those we encounter.


Romans 1:16 speaks to the unifying power of the gospel message, which transcends cultural and social boundaries to offer salvation to all who believe. This verse emboldens us to share our hope in Christ without shame or hesitation, embracing our role as ambassadors for the transformative love of God.

Call to Christ


To deepen your commitment to sharing your hope in Christ and cultivate a greater sense of readiness for faith-based conversations, consider the following actions:


  1. Engage in daily scripture study: Dedicate time each day to exploring the Bible, focusing on passages that relate to personal testimony, evangelism, and the transformative power of the gospel message. Reflect on how these insights can inform your approach to sharing your hope in Christ with others.


  2. Develop your personal testimony: Craft a concise and genuine account of your faith journey, highlighting key moments of transformation and the impact that Christ has had on your life. Share your testimony with friends, family, or fellow believers, inviting feedback and encouragement as you refine your narrative.


  3. Participate in evangelism training: Join a small group, workshop, or online course focused on effective methods for sharing your faith with gentleness and respect. Learn from the experiences of others and apply these insights to your own practice.


  4. Create opportunities for faith-based conversations: Proactively engage with your community by hosting small group discussions, attending local events, or volunteering with organizations that serve those in need. Use these interactions as opportunities to share your hope in Christ and listen to the stories of others.


  5. Develop a prayer routine for evangelism: Commit to praying regularly for guidance, wisdom, and courage as you engage in faith-based conversations. Lift up the individuals you encounter, asking for God's love and truth to be revealed through your interactions.


  6. Learn from the examples of others: Study the lives of influential evangelists, missionaries, and disciples throughout history, examining how their commitment to sharing the gospel message impacted the world around them. Reflect on the lessons you can apply to your own practice.


  7. Practice empathetic listening: Cultivate a genuine interest in the experiences and beliefs of others, seeking to understand their unique perspectives and how your personal testimony might speak to their spiritual needs. By listening with compassion and curiosity, you can foster more meaningful connections and create opportunities for sharing your hope in Christ.
